## Provenance: Tilehound Prefetcher

Tilehound prefetches map tiles for the Wayfern client. Each release embeds its source revision and builder identity at link time. Reviewers: verify the embedded provenance matches the merge commit before approving promotion to staging. The artifact under review carries the build token shown below.

session token of kafof-kafop = htk31_c3becf8b8eac3ed970037fba36e258e

Subject: Quickstore 4.2 — bloom filter now fronts the KV layer

Plugin authors: starting with this release, Quickstore places a bloom filter ahead of the key-value store. Negative lookups return faster; false positives fall through safely. No API changes are required on your side. Verify your plugin against the staging build referenced below.

session token of fahif-tadup = htk3_9c7

Internal Memo — Revised Sales-Commission Scheme

Heads of department should note that Torvane Instruments will adopt a tiered commission structure from the new fiscal year, weighting recurring revenue over one-off sales. Accelerators apply above quota; clawbacks apply to early cancellations. Full tables follow by circular. One confidential element accompanies this memo immediately below.

confidential, kajof-tahof: The pricing group signed off on a budget of $491.8 million for Project Casvan.

### Runbook: Eventmesh Schema Registry

All events flowing through Eventmesh must have a registered schema, otherwise producers get rejected at publish time. Don't panic if you see rejection spikes — it's usually someone deploying a schema change out of order. Check the registry's compatibility mode first; it explains most incidents. The registry runs with the following settings in production.

deployment values, taduf-fawig:
WENAEL_HOST=wenael.zemvarlabs.internal
WENAEL_PORT=8443